Authorities Identify Teen Shot And Killed At Party In Rancho Cordova

RANCHO CORDOVA (CBS13) – Authorities have identified a teen who was shot and killed at a party on Sunday morning.

When police arrived at the scene of the large, loud party in the 3600 block of Sarament Court, they found 17-year-old Joseph Burrola of Rio Linda unconscious. He was later pronounced dead at the scene, say police.

Police say they were first called to the scene to break up the party just before midnight. Officers say about 100 people were in attendance. Just after 2 a.m., officers say they were called to the scene again after reports about a large fight and gunshots.

Police later learned that two other people were shot at the party and were driven to the hospital. One of those victims, a man in his 20s, had to undergo immediate surgery due to a life-threatening gunshot wound. The other man's injury is not life-threatening.

Two other people were injured in the fight and were taken to the hospital.

Detectives believe the shooting happened after a large group of people returned to the party after being told to leave by officers. At some point after coming back, the group turned violent and the fight escalated to a shooting.
